Bio

Kristin Bauer van Straten is an American actress best known for her role as Nico, a porn star, in the 2000 feature film Dancing at the Blue Iguana; and for her role as Fangtasia co-owner Pam in the horror drama television series True Blood, from 2008-2014.

Born and raised in Racine County, Wisconsin, Kristin had an idyllic childhood centered around nature and animals. In junior high, she became interested in the arts, specifically drawing.

Being done with academics, after graduation she compiled a portfolio and applied to fine arts school in St. Louis, Boston and New York, of which she attended all three. In 1993, Bauer decided to pursue a career in acting and moved to Los Angeles, California.

While juggling her various odd jobs, she was asked to become part of a movie which earned her more in a day than she was getting in a month.

She still continued drawing and painting while she began appearing on television and in film during the mid-'90s, making her small screen debut in a 1994 episode of L.A. Law. Her first major television break came the following year when she was hired to portray flight attendant Maggie Reynolds on the FOX comedy The Crew, which lasted for one season.

In 1996, Kristin appeared in one of her most memorable guest roles as "Man Hands" Gillian, Jerry's girlfriend, on Seinfeld.

Throughout the years, she has played a few other series regular characters including the Geneva Renault, the buxom secretary of a high-tech security agency, on the short-lived action drama Total Security; Candy Cooper in the CBS family drama That's Life; and the sexy, softball "porn mom" on the NBC comedy Hidden Hills.

In 2008, Alan Ball tapped her to co-manage the vampire bar Fangtasia with formidable Viking Eric Northman (Alexander Skarsgard) on HBO's original drama True Blood.

Today she lives in Los Angeles with her musician husband Abri van Straten and two rescued dogs. She splits her time between shooting, painting and trying to bring light to things that should not be happening.

She works with IFAW, The Amanda Foundation and other charities. Nature and animals are her greatest passion as they "Have always given selflessly to me, so much more than I ever could have dreamed or given back. Mother nature is the greatest, most magical artist I have ever seen."
